Tekst achterflap
Global wealth is distributed unevenly, and the reasons behind this imbalance are complex and often misunderstood. This book examines the historical, geographic, institutional, and economic factors that have shaped why some nations prospered while others struggled to develop. You will explore how colonial history, governance structures, trade patterns, education systems, and natural resources have all played a part in shaping national economies over time. Generated with the assistance of artificial intelligence, this book draws on established research and economic theory to present a clear, accessible overview of a topic long debated by scholars. Rather than offering simple answers, it lays out the major explanations side by side, helping you understand the layered and interconnected causes of global inequality. It serves as an introductory guide for readers seeking a grounded understanding of this subject.
